GridView中添加连续的编号列(序号列 ) 连续的编号,不绑定ID

        因为:有时候因为人为设定表的ID主键时,不小心或特意的设定,使得表中ID主键不连续,当在GridView中绑定定该列时,

主键ID不是连续的就显示不雅观。因此:下面我教大家制定连续的序号列(编号)。

        1.在绑定ID的DataFiled列中,去除添加的绑定(也就是不绑定内容)如图:

 

接着  在GridView的RowDataBind事件中作一些处理,代码如下:

 private     void    GridView_RowDataBind( object  sender , EventArgs   e )

   {

            if ( e.Row.RowType== DataControlRowType.DataRow)

               {

                      e.Row.Cells[ 0 ].Text=(e.Row.RowIndex+1).ToString() ;

              }

   }

 

posted @ 2012-11-17 17:39  酒沉吟  阅读(311)  评论(0编辑  收藏  举报